Mrs. Ida M. Wernecke, 95, of 1412 Madison Street, Manitowoc, died
Monday, July 13, 1987 at Froedtert Memorial Lutheran Hospital,
Wauwatosa, Wisconsin. Funeral services will be 2 pm Friday at First
German Evangelical Lutheran Church, Manitowoc. Rev. Arno Wolfgramm will
officiate and interment will be in Evergreen Cemetery, Manitowoc.
Mrs. Wernecke was born December 19, 1891 in the Town of Newton, daughter
of the late Herman and Sophie Vetting Wernecke. She was educated in
Newton. She married Fred Wernecke on October 29, 1913, in the Town of
Newton. The couple farmed until 1960 when they came to Manitowoc. Her
husband preceded her in death in 1960. Mrs. Wernecke was a member of
First German Evangelical Lutheran Church.
Survivors include a son and daughter-in-law, Norman and Eleanor Wernecke
of Wauwatosa; a daughter and son-in-law, Evelyn and Leland Stuckmann of
Manitowoc; two granddaughters and their husbands, Carol and Kevin
McCradden of Eden Prairie, Minnesota and Karen and Robert Eno of
Plymouth, Minnesota, and two great grandchildren, Michael and Megan Eno.
She was preceded in death by a son and three brothers.
Friends may call at Jens Funeral Home, Manitowoc, 5 pm to 9 pm Thursday
and Friday from 9 am to 11 am and then at the church from 12 noon to the
time of services.
Manitowoc Herald Times, Wed., July 15, 1987 page 18
